Overview


The Code Enforcement Department's goal is to protect the public's health, safety and welfare, while ensuring the citizen's rights to a clean, enjoyable neighborhood. Primary duties include providing information about City codes (City and Zoning) for property maintenance, zoning and signage, and encouraging voluntary compliance. Proactive field inspections and response to citizen complaints lead to enforcement through established procedures when voluntary compliance does not occur.

Report a Violation


There are two ways to report a violation, you can fill out an online form or contact the Code Enforcement Officer, Rena Quale, directly.

When contacting Ms. Quale please give the exact address of the property in violation, if possible, and explain in detail what you believe to be in violation. You are not required to leave your name and telephone number when you report a violation, but it is helpful. In some cases, the Code Enforcement Officer may need to obtain more information from you to resolve the violation, or let you know that the complaint was not a valid code violation.

Please note: All records are public information. If you wish to remain anonymous in your complaint, you will not be updated on the status or outcome of the case.
